Transaction 77e99f5076060caec90996a9197dbd56e9a5e148d9a47e8c246af7136cb42ffb

2 Input
2 Outputs
  • 77e99f5076060caec90996a9197dbd56e9a5e148d9a47e8c246af7136cb42ffb:0
  • value  1200000000
    address  3HQmNLbUyAAX5TbPxoWaVzormBNVcMW8LC
  • 77e99f5076060caec90996a9197dbd56e9a5e148d9a47e8c246af7136cb42ffb:1
  • value  3700704
    address  3Kw73QrErTNfKAh54wrzp5zTAMJV3RsboX